The game, step by step

Your phone becomes your investigation notebook.

Choose a trail, form your team and follow the guide from place to place. Each stage reveals a riddle, challenge or detail to observe.

From your first choice to the final secret

The trail guides you throughout the adventure, leaving you free to focus on the places, clues and your team.

  1. Choose your trail

    Filter adventures by location, duration, difficulty, theme or transport. Each page gives you the practical information you need.

    1
  2. Name your team

    The team joins from one phone. Free content can be started without an account; the trail page tells you whether a sign-in, purchase or access code is required.

    2
  3. Reach the starting point

    The address and starting instructions appear on the trail page. Once there, open the trail on your phone.

    Remember to allow location access when the trail uses it.

    3
  4. Move from stage to stage

    Depending on the adventure, stages unlock on location or remain available in a roadbook. Follow the instructions on screen.

    4
  5. Solve the challenges

    Quizzes, riddles, estimates, photos and mini-games call on observation, logic and teamwork. Hints can help you move forward.

    5
  6. Discover your result

    At the end, see your score, badges, challenge summary and, when included in the format, the team leaderboard.

Before you set off

A few quick checks will help you enjoy the trail in good conditions.

  • A charged phone

    The game runs in the browser of the phone used by your team.

  • A mobile connection

    It loads stages, sends answers and keeps track of your progress.

  • Location access if needed

    Some trails use it to confirm your arrival at each stage.

  • Suitable clothing

    Check the duration, distance and transport mode before setting off.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need an account?

Not always. Free trails and free previews may be available to guests. An account is needed to buy certain trails, retrieve games and keep badges.

How many phones do we need?

One connected phone is enough per team. Keep it charged and choose someone to read instructions while the group observes and discusses.

What happens if we leave the page?

An active game can be resumed. The trail page lets your team return to the stage where it stopped.

Can several teams play?

Yes. Group and event formats split participants into teams and can include a shared leaderboard.
